An edge case, but some 30 years ago or so I was told that in some supermarkets in Brazil, there could be a central display changing prices daily (due to the hyperinflation) and besides supermarkets people went shopping as early as possible on shop openings to get "yesterday's prices":

https://www.npr.org/sections/money/2010/10/04/130329523/how-...

>In practice, this meant stores had to change their prices every day. The guy in the grocery store would walk the aisles putting new price stickers on the food. Shoppers would run ahead of him, so they could buy their food at the previous day’s price.
